Paul John Holmes (born 25 August 1988) is a British Conservative Party politician who has been the Member of Parliament (MP) for Hamble Valley since 2024. He was the Member of Parliament for Eastleigh from 2019 to 2024. Holmes currently serves as Shadow Minister for Housing, Communities and Local Government having been appointed by Kemi Badenoch.
